Trust the ACPI code to disable TSC instead when C3 is used. AMD Fam10h does not disable TSC in any C states so the check was incorrect there anyways after the change to handle this like Intel on AMD too.
This allows to use the TSC when C3 is disabled in software (acpi.max_c_state=2), but the BIOS supports it anyways. Match i386 behaviour.
